Phreesia, Inc. (NYSE:PHR) CEO Chaim Indig Sells 12,043 Shares of Stock

Phreesia, Inc. (NYSE:PHRGet Free Report) CEO Chaim Indig sold 12,043 shares of Phreesia stock in a transaction dated Monday, April 8th. The stock was sold at an average price of $22.62, for a total value of $272,412.66. Following the sale, the chief executive officer now directly owns 1,225,397 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$27,718,480.14.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through this hyperlink.

Chaim Indig also recently made the following trade(s):

  • On Tuesday, January 16th, Chaim Indig sold 3,586 shares of Phreesia stock. The shares were sold at an average price of $24.55, for a total value of $88,036.30.

Phreesia (NYSE:PHRG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, March 14th. The company reported ($0.56) ear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.58) by $0.02. Phreesia had a negative net margin of 38.42% and a negative return on equity of 53.33%. The business had revenue of $95.00 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$93.52 million.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ned ($0.72) earnings per share.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 24.0%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that Phreesia, Inc. will post -1.48 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Phreesia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Phreesia, Inc provides an integrated SaaS-based software and payment platform for the healthcare industry in the United States and Canada. The company offers access solutions that offers appointment scheduling system for online appointments, reminders, and referral tracking management; registration solution to automate patient self-registration; revenue cycle solution, which offer insurance-verification processes, point-of-sale payments applications, post-visit payment collection, and flexible payment options; and network connect solution to deliver clinically relevant content to patients.
